On the night of December 10-11, 2021, a terrible tragedy struck residents of the US as several powerful tornadoes wreaked havoc in five states in the South and Midwest. There were 32 reports of tornadoes in a 24-hour period.
Sadly, many people have been killed. There are those who got injured. The fate of hundreds of people is still unknown as search and rescue efforts continue.
The storm wiped out entire neighborhoods of cities: thousands of families were left homeless, more than 300,000 residents were left without electricity, and more than 16 000 000 people were affected in total.
